Computer Engineering in Public Health jobs blend advanced computing with efforts to safeguard population health. This interdisciplinary field applies hardware, software, and algorithmic expertise to tackle issues like disease surveillance and health policy analysis. For a full definition of Public Health jobs, explore the dedicated page, but here we focus on how Computer Engineering transforms it through digital innovation.
At its core, Public Health means the science and art of preventing disease, prolonging life, and promoting health through organized community efforts, as defined by C.E.A. Winslow in 1920. Computer Engineering contributes by developing systems for real-time data processing from wearables and sensors, enabling predictive analytics for epidemics.
The integration began in the late 20th century as computers enabled complex epidemiological models. In the 1990s, Geographic Information Systems (GIS) mapped disease spreads. The 2000s brought big data from genomics, and by 2020, AI models forecasted COVID-19 trajectories with 90% accuracy in some studies. Today, universities worldwide train specialists for these roles, driven by global health threats.
Academic professionals design software for outbreak detection, analyze genomic data for vaccine development, and create apps for contact tracing. For instance, engineers at Harvard developed models that informed US pandemic responses. Responsibilities include grant writing, teaching courses on data science in health, and collaborating on interdisciplinary teams.
To secure Computer Engineering jobs in Public Health, candidates need strong academic credentials and practical expertise.
A PhD in Computer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Computer Science, or Biomedical Informatics with a Public Health emphasis is standard. Many hold dual degrees or certifications in epidemiology.
Specialize in AI for health prediction, network analysis for social determinants of health, or cybersecurity for medical data systems.
Prior publications (e.g., 5+ in high-impact journals like Nature Computational Science), successful grants from bodies like the NIH or WHO, and 2-3 years of postdoctoral work.
